FujiFilm F70EXR vs Panasonic TS5 Overview

Its time to look more closely at the FujiFilm F70EXR vs Panasonic TS5, former being a Small Sensor Compact while the latter is a Waterproof by manufacturers FujiFilm and Panasonic. There is a substantial difference between the resolutions of the F70EXR (10MP) and TS5 (16MP) and the F70EXR (1/2") and TS5 (1/2.3") boast different sensor sizes.

FujiFilm F70EXR vs Panasonic TS5 Physical Comparison

In case you're going to lug around your camera often, you will want to think about its weight and volume. The FujiFilm F70EXR comes with external dimensions of 99mm x 59mm x 23m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.9") along with a weight of 205 grams (0.45 lbs) whilst the Panasonic TS5 has sizing of 110mm x 67mm x 29mm (4.3" x 2.6" x 1.1") with a weight of 214 grams (0.47 lbs).

FujiFilm F70EXR vs Panasonic TS5 Sensor Comparison

Oftentimes, it's tough to visualize the contrast between sensor measurements merely by checking technical specs. The graphic underneath will offer you a better sense of the sensor dimensions in the F70EXR and TS5.

As you have seen, the 2 cameras have different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The F70EXR using its bigger sensor is going to make getting shallower DOF simpler and the Panasonic TS5 will give greater detail using its extra 6 Megapixels. Higher resolution will also allow you to crop shots a bit more aggressively. The older F70EXR is going to be behind in sensor tech.
